Canyon Ferry: Rainbow fishing continues to be slow, but anglers are catching a few, both trolling and from shore, using worms near White Earth and the Dam. Walleye action has been fair around the Silos and Goose Bay trolling worm harnesses tipped with worms. A few perch are being caught by anglers while searching for walleye. Adam Strainer, FWP, Helena
Hauser: Rainbow fishing is slow with a few trout being caught from shore at the Causeway Bridge and Riverside while using worms or marshmallows. Boat anglers are finding a few trout while trolling cowbells around the White Sandy/Black Sandy area. A few walleye are being caught in the Causeway and below Canyon Ferry Dam on jigs with a worm. Troy Humphrey, FWP, Helena
Holter: Rainbow fishing is good while trolling rapalas or cowbells around Cottonwood Creek and Split Rock. A few rainbows are being caught from shore at Departure Point while using worms and Gates of the Mountains on Wooly Buggers. Perch fishing is good around Cottonwood Creek, Mann Gulch and Willow Creek while using jigs and worms in 12 to 20 feet of water. A few walleye are being caught in the Gates of the Mountains canyon on jigs and worms. Troy Humphrey, FWP, Helena
